    2025 Field Day Posters

     

    Postdoctoral Associates

    Dr. Ricardo Lesmes Evaluation of Energycane for Biomass Yield and Ecosystem Services on Fallow Croplands in Florida.

    Dr. Shabnam Sadeghibaniani How The Right Phosphorus Rates Influences the Yield of Lettuce.

    Dr. Larissa Carvalho Ferreira Harnessing the Microbial Reservoir of the Everglades Agricultural Area for Sustainable Management of Early Blight Disease in Celery.

    Students

    Walter Wong Battling Weeds in Lettuce: A Fresh Take with Pendimethalin.

    Amandeep Sahil Sharma How Energycane can improve sustainability in EAA cropping systems.

    Carolina Tieppo Camarozano Tiny wasps, Big impact: The potential of Telenomus podisi in sustainably managing Rice Stink Bugs.

    Adrian Chavez Managing Invasive Pests: The case of Thrips parvispinus in pepper in Florida.

    Tennyson Nkhoma Promoting Resilience to Western Flower Thrips in Florida Lettuce Production.

    Juan Sebastian Angel-Salazar Aphids in Sugarcane: Decoding Their Role in Sugarcane Ecosystem.

    Kelvin Aloryi Combating heat stress to deliver climate-resilient lettuce for sustainable production.

    Jairo Arcos Jaramillo Making your salads cheaper and greener: genetic improvements in lettuce for reduced use of fertilizers.

    Byron Manzanero Stronger plants, safer crops: overcoming diseases in lettuce through plant breeding.

    Lidysce Andrea Mata Cantarero Adapting Lettuce for a Hotter Future.

    Jesse Murray Lettuce has Nutritional Compounds Beneficial to Humans and Plants.

    Fernanda Rodrigues Silva Curly Leaf: What is Causing it on Celery in the EAA?.

    Ludmila Lopes Silva Fusarium Yellows Race 2 confirmed in Florida.

    MD Anik Mahmud Investigating legacy phosphorus availability in acidic, organic, and calcareous soils.

    Berson Valcin Treatment Technologies for Phosphorus Mitigation.
